Food Justice: Addressing Hunger and Inequality

Food justice encompasses the belief that everyone deserves access to healthy food regardless of their socioeconomic status. Addressing hunger and inequality is crucial for social equity.

The Hunger Crisis in America

Millions of Americans face food insecurity, which can have detrimental effects on physical and mental health. Understanding the root causes of hunger is key to addressing this crisis.

Community-Led Initiatives

Many communities are taking action through local farms, community gardens, and food co-ops, working towards food sovereignty and ensuring equitable access to nutritious food.

Impact of Policy on Food Justice

Policies that support sustainable agriculture and food distribution can help alleviate hunger. Local governments can play a significant role in fostering food justice through effective legislation.

Case Study: The Food Bank Network

The Food Bank Network illustrates the power of collaborative efforts in distributing food to those in need. Their initiatives highlight the importance of community solidarity.

Future Directions in Food Justice

Holistic approaches that address the underlying causes of food inequality are essential. This includes education about nutrition and cooking, as well as supporting local food systems.

Conclusion

Food justice is essential for addressing hunger and inequality in our society. By fostering community initiatives and supportive policies, we can create a more equitable food system.
